Roland Wagner, Jürgen Palkoska, Andreas Langegger,
"Simplifying a Web Application´s Architecture - the DaVinci Framework"
, in G. Kotsis, D. Taniar, S. Bressan, I.K. Ibrahim, S. Mokhtar: books@ocg.at, 7th Int. Conference on Information Integration and Web-based Applications & Services (iiWAS 2005), Vol. 196, OCG, Seite(n) 643-654, 9-2005, ISBN: 3-85403-196-3, Andreas Langegger, Jürgen Palkoska, Roland Wagner: Simplifying a Web Application´s Architecture - the DaVinci Framework in: The Seventh International Conference on Information Integration and Web-based Applications and Services (iiWAS 2005), Vol. 2, G. Kotsis, D. Taniar, S. Bressan, I.K. Ibrahim, S. Mokhtar (eds.), September 19-21, 2005, Kuala Lumpur Malaysia, [ISBN 3-85403-196-3], pp. 643-654
Original Titel:
Simplifying a Web Application´s Architecture - the DaVinci Framework
Sprache des Titels:
Englisch
Original Buchtitel:
books@ocg.at, 7th Int. Conference on Information Integration and Web-based Applications & Services (iiWAS 2005)
Original Kurzfassung:
The World Wide Web has undergone a rapid transition from the originally static hypertext
to an ubiquitous hypermedia system. Today, the web is often used as a basis for distributed applications.
That’s why many research work has already been done about the modeling and engineering
process for web applications. Many of the published concepts try to merge hypertext modeling with
traditional techniques from the software engineering domain. Unfortunately, those concepts which
capture all facets of the web’s architecture become rather bulky and are eventually not applicable for
serious development. The missing adoption in industry indicates this. It seems that web engineering
based on the blank architecture of the WWW is no promising approach. Moreover, there is a need
for architectural frameworks. Such a framework should address both, the modeling process and the
implementation.
DaVinci1 is the prototype of a proposed framework. It is a modeling framework as well as a framework
supporting the implementation of web applications. For the modeling process UML is used. The
architecture is based on the Model View Controller type 2 pattern. The major features of DaVinci are
the hierarchical GUI tree and a special URL scheme to facilitate the interaction process.
Sprache der Kurzfassung:
Englisch
Veröffentlicher:
OCG
Volume:
196
Seitenreferenz:
643-654
Erscheinungsmonat:
9
Erscheinungsjahr:
2005
Notiz zum Zitat:
Andreas Langegger, Jürgen Palkoska, Roland Wagner: Simplifying a Web Application´s Architecture - the DaVinci Framework in: The Seventh International Conference on Information Integration and Web-based Applications and Services (iiWAS 2005), Vol. 2, G. Kotsis, D. Taniar, S. Bressan, I.K. Ibrahim, S. Mokhtar (eds.), September 19-21, 2005, Kuala Lumpur Malaysia, [ISBN 3-85403-196-3], pp. 643-654